Logan Morgan was born in 1886 in Tennessee, USA, the child of James G Morgan And Hettyann Rosalee Stout. In 1900, Logan Morgan resided in Civil District 4, Carter, Tennessee, USA. In 1910, Logan Morgan resided in Civil District 4, Carter, Tennessee, USA. Logan Morgan married Malinda Potter, and had children including Larry W Wiley Morgan, Leonard Morgan, No Nane Morgan, Troy Morgan, Willard David Morgan. Logan Morgan passed away in 1917 in Carter Co, Tennessee.
